Jeffrey Epstein: A Brief Biography

Jeffrey Edward Epstein was born on January 20, 1953, in Brooklyn, New York. He rose from modest beginnings to become a prominent financier, establishing connections with powerful figures across politics, business, and entertainment. Epstein's career began as a teacher before transitioning to finance, where he worked at Bear Stearns before founding his own firm.

The Assault Allegations: What Really Happened?

The assault allegations surrounding Jeffrey Epstein refer to two significant incidents that occurred while he was in custody at the Metropolitan Correctional Center in New York City. These incidents raised serious questions about prison security, Epstein's safety, and the circumstances leading to his eventual death.

The July 23, 2019 Incident

On July 23, 2019, just weeks after Epstein's arrest on federal sex trafficking charges, corrections officers discovered him semi-conscious in his cell with marks on his neck. The incident sparked immediate speculation about whether it was a suicide attempt or an assault by another inmate. Epstein was treated at a hospital and returned to the same facility, where he was placed on suicide watch.

The August 10, 2019 Death

The second and most significant "assault" allegation involves the circumstances surrounding Epstein's death on August 10, 2019. While officially ruled as suicide by hanging, many questions remain unanswered about how this could have occurred given the high-profile nature of his case. The autopsy revealed multiple broken bones in Epstein's neck, which some experts say are more consistent with strangulation than hanging.

The Investigation and Official Response

Following both incidents, multiple investigations were launched to determine what exactly occurred. The Bureau of Prisons, FBI, and Department of Justice all conducted separate inquiries into Epstein's death and the security failures that allowed it to happen.

Security Failures and Negligence

The investigations revealed numerous security failures at the Metropolitan Correctional Center. Guards had fallen asleep, falsified records, and failed to conduct required checks on Epstein. These failures directly contradicted the heightened security measures that should have been in place for such a high-profile inmate.

The Florida Plea Deal Controversy

In 2008, Epstein received a controversial plea deal in Florida that many critics argue was far too lenient given the severity of his crimes. This deal, which allowed him to serve only 13 months in a county jail with work release privileges, later became the subject of intense scrutiny and legal challenges.

Civil Lawsuits and Compensation

Numerous civil lawsuits were filed by Epstein's victims seeking compensation for the harm they suffered. Many of these cases resulted in settlements, with Epstein's estate ultimately agreeing to pay substantial sums to his victims.
